How Big Is A Standard Kitchen Island . The standard height of your island should be 36 inches — raisable up to 42 inches if you are using the island for dining purposes. A vital factor in a successful design is the space around the island. however, although there isn’t a standard kitchen island size, there is a kitchen island average size and this is 40 by 80 inches (around 1 by 2 metres).
